In Brazil, a thriving media landscape offers abundant avenues for aspiring journalists to hone their craft and make a tangible impact. One pathway that stands out is becoming a certified stringer. A stringer is a freelance journalist who works on assignment for larger news organizations, providing current reports from the field.
